Music
- Enhanced musical memory and auditory skills by learning and memorizing complex choral arrangements for performances.
- Improved vocal technique and control through regular practice and vocal exercises required for group choir singing.
- Developed a sense of rhythm and timing by synchronizing with the choir conductor and other choir members during performances, refining musical timing skills.
Tips
To further enhance development in choir activities, encourage the student to explore solo singing opportunities within the group choir to boost confidence and individual vocal skills. Additionally, suggest organizing small ensemble performances to foster teamwork and deepen musical connections with peers. Encouraging the student to actively participate in choir repertoire selection can also cultivate a sense of ownership and passion for the music performed.
